🛠️ CipherStrike v1.0 – Initial Release
CipherStrike makes its debut as a potent, Python-driven ransomware simulation tool, tailored for EDR testing. This release equips security teams with the ability to simulate encryption, data exfiltration, and C2 server interaction — all without the real-world damage. Perfect for red teamers and cybersecurity experts seeking to strengthen their defenses.
🚀 Key Features in v1.0
-
🛡️ Simulates Ransomware Attacks: Encrypts files and mimics real-world ransomware behavior.
-
💻 Command-and-Control (C2) Server: Allows communication between attacker and infected systems.
-
🔐 File Encryption: Uses AES encryption to secure victim data.
-
💾 Data Exfiltration: Sends encrypted data to a C2 server for testing exfiltration detection.
-
📝 Ransom Note: Generates a ransom note for victim systems to simulate a full attack scenario.
🧪 Tested On:
- Kali Linux
- Ubuntu
- macOS
- Windows 10 / 11
